ProntoForms Announces that Fortune 500 Medical Device Customer Adds Over 3500 Subscriptions and Enables Over 9000 Globally

The solution empowers cross-geographical preventative maintenance service on individual devices

OTTAWA, Feb. 03, 2022 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— ProntoForms Corporation (TSXV: PFM), the global leader in no-code app development platforms for field teams, is pleased to announce that an existing Fortune 500 medical device customer has expanded their ProntoForms implementation by 3500 subscriptions for a total of over 9000 subscriptions globally to support asset installation and preventive maintenance service across multiple business units.

The company is a global leader in innovative healthcare technology with over 30,000 employees across 100 countries. Prior to this expansion, the company had implemented ProntoForms’ solution throughout North America, EMEA, Latin America, and parts of APAC. ProntoForms enables their technicians to service devices effectively and in compliance with device- and jurisdiction-specific regulations. The recent expansion in the same global footprint supports the installation and preventive maintenance of over 4000 unique medical devices, including MRIs.

Scalable Processes that Maximize Uptime and Compliance

ProntoForms’ unique capabilities for scalable, offline workflows instilled the confidence to expand. With a single ProntoForms workflow able to handle maintenance for an entire product line, field engineers’ work is greatly simplified by guiding them through a wide range of scenarios. ProntoForms’ mobile and cloud integration with a leading field service management system and a leading customer relationship management platform enable a best-of-breed solution. The customer’s field engineers have quickly embraced the use of ProntoForms.

Low-code tools enable the customer’s non-technical, business users to build and maintain ProntoForms for multiple product lines. Workflow features like ProntoForms Teamwork and data collection features like Answer Exceptions enable business technologists to build workflows that address the challenges of installing and maintaining complex medical assets. This facilitates work that spans multiple days and requires the input of multiple engineers. It also enables effective assessment of “hard” and “soft” device failures, which is key to optimizing asset uptime and compliance.
